    So the Jaapies made:

    103/1 off the first 20
    80/5 off the next 20
    89/1 off the final 10

    That second 20 overs is poor and too many wickets down probably cost 10 runs in the final 10.

    With the start they made, I'm going to say they should have made 300 - but, then it was probably a better than par start.

    So overall - maybe 280 is par.

    Good thing for us is that we're not going out needing to score like madmen from the start - which is good for people like Latham, Kane and Rossco.

    Other good thing is that I reckon batting is the Jaaps strong suit. Missing Steyn, Philander, Morkel and Morris - not sure how many of those guys play in their best ODI team these days, but some of them.

    Not losing wickets to Tahir will go a long way here.
